Cyril Raymond breaks clear

Cyril Raymond scored his third victory of the year to extend his lead in both the French Junior Rallycross Championship and Twingo R1 Rallycross Cup standings. Turning in a polished performance in Sunday’s A Final at Mayenne, he crossed the line first from Aurelien Crochard and Pascal Huteau.

Cyril Raymond dominated the qualifying heats to claim pole position for the A Final from Aurelien Crochard and Tom Daunat, with Julien Anodeau, Firmin Cadeddu and Aymeric Armange lining up behind them.

Enzo Libner and Pascal Huteau joined them on the grid thanks to respective first and second places in the B Final, while Fabien Grosset-Janin missed out after only finishing third.

Aurelien Crochard’s fast start gave him the lead from Cyril Raymond and Enzo Libner, though poleman Raymond moved back in front on the joker lap and stayed there to record win number three of the season.

The championship leader was joined on the podium by Aurelien Crochard and Pascal Huteau, with Enzo Libner taking fourth ahead of Tom Daunat, Firmin Cadeddu, Julien Anodeau and Aymeric Armange.

Finishing 15th overall, Lucie Grosset-Janin was the first female driver home, followed by Sandra Vincent (20th overall) and Manuele Closmenil (21st).

2013 French Junior Rallycross Championship standings
1. Cyril Raymond, 112 points
2. Aurelien Crochard, 104
3. Fabien Grosset-Janin, 95
4. Enzo Libner, 88 pts
5. Tom Daunat, 87

2013 Twingo R1 Rallycross Cup standings
1. Cyril Raymond, 123 points
2. Aurelien Crochard, 98
3. Julien Anodeau, 97
4. Fabien Grosset-Janin, 90
5. Enzo Libner, 81
